Listed building consent is needed for work that affects the special interest of a listed building, inside or out, on top of planning permission. Setting can be a consideration for buildings nearby; there is no fixed radius.

Nutrient neutrality catchment: Brue Catchment
New homes and overnight accommodation must show nutrient neutrality before approval.
Natural England advice: extra wastewater in these catchments harms protected habitats, so schemes must offset their nutrient load, usually through credits.
Wells conservation area
Demolition needs planning permission and permitted development is restricted.
The council must give weight to preserving or enhancing the area's character and appearance. Not every council has published its boundaries as open data.
